George scores one, assists two as Chelsea U18s beat Ajayi's Tottenham Hotspur
Published: February 17, 2024
Flying Eagles-eligible winger Tyrique George was in stellar form yet again for Chelsea U18s as they beat London rivals Tottenham 4-1 in the U18 Premier League on Saturday afternoon.
The Anglo-Nigerian was involved in the opener, winning the ball back before passing to Frankie Runham whose deflected effort gave the young Blues the lead.
Reiss-Alexander Russell-Denny doubled the lead in the 38th minute with a fine finish, assisted by Josh-Kofi Acheampong who did a brilliant job to create the goal.
Hassan Sulaiman's side will take the two-goal cushion into the end of the first half and it didn't take long before they added to their tally after the restart.
Two minutes into the second half, George found himself unmarked in the penalty box and he slotted the ball precisely into the back of the net.
The 18-year-old will become the provider yet again for Chelsea's fourth goal of the afternoon, putting a precise cross for Josh Acheampong who headed the ball home.
Another Nigeria-eligible forward, Damola Ajayi scored the consolation goal for the home side in the 71st minute.
George has now scored 6 goals in the U18 Premier League and he has also contributed four assists in just 7 games.
